Justin. I have been telling you the problem since December. It doesn't matter. 4.4 or 5.1. The box comes with a remote with a USB dongle. I have tried both mygica remotes they come with with the dongle. It doesn't matter. It could be a dongle for a mouse a keyboard  even a space ship. When the box is shut off In standby and you have a USB dongle plugged in the box does not turn on. And if it does turn on with some remotes the remote doesn't function properly. THERE WAS A BATCH THAT HAS AN EFFED UP TURN ON PROCESS WHEN A USB IS PLUGGED IN.  you need to fix what's broken and not what's not. Kr41 does not turn on after standby. 

Kr40 will turn on after standby but the remote doesn't function properly without a reboot. 

Kr60 no USB dongle plugged in no problem

kr60 with USB dongle does not turn on. Needs to be unplugged.

If this is still unclear let me know. 

This is a problem on 4.4 and after a 5.1 upgrade. 1st box returned. Second box kept and waiting on a fix that is never coming
